Is deck C an advantageous deck in the Iowa Gambling Task?

Summary
Participants in a modified Iowa Gambling Task (IGT) showed no preference for advantageous decks, challenging previous findings. This suggests the original IGT may misinterpret decision-making, particularly regarding gain-loss frequency.
Area of Science:
- Cognitive Psychology
- Neuroscience
- Decision-Making Research
Background:
- Critical reviews identified issues with the Somatic Marker Hypothesis (SMH), focusing on replication challenges.
- The "prominent deck B phenomenon" in the original Iowa Gambling Task (IGT) was identified, suggesting deck C preference due to gain-loss frequency, not final outcome.
- A modified IGT was designed to balance gain-loss frequency between decks A and C to test this hypothesis.
Purpose of the Study:
- To verify the hypothesis that decision-makers prefer deck C based on gain-loss frequency rather than final outcome.
- To investigate the "sunken deck C" phenomenon in a modified IGT with high-contrast gain-loss values.
- To re-evaluate the core assumptions and interpretations of the original IGT.
Main Methods:
- Recruited 48 college students (24 males, 24 females).
- Utilized a two-stage IGT with high-contrast gain-loss values.
- Administered post-game questionnaires to assess conscious awareness and final preferences.
Main Results:
- Participants chose deck C with nearly identical frequency to deck A, despite deck C's better final outcome.
- The "sunken deck C" phenomenon was observed in both stages of the modified IGT.
- Questionnaires revealed participants consciously disliked deck C.
Conclusions:
- In the modified IGT, deck C was not preferred despite its superior long-term outcome, contradicting basic IGT assumptions.
- Identified pseudo-balance in gain-loss frequency between decks A and C in the original IGT.
- The "sunken deck C" phenomenon may lead to misinterpretation of gain-loss frequency effects and overstatement of decision-maker foresight in existing IGT studies.
